Chef Tips and Tricks
- Pound Chicken to 1″ thick for even cooking.
- Season the chicken with salt and pepper before dredging with flour.
- Use Fresh Basil.
- Use a cast iron pan or a quality Stainless Steel for even cooking.
- Serve immediately for the best results.

We used a broad Linguini noodle but you can also use angel hair pasta.
Yes, you can substitute boneless skinless chicken thighs instead of breasts.
Store the leftovers in a sealed air-tight container in the fridge for up to 3 days.
Reheat in the microwave or in the oven, you will need to add a splash of water to thin out the sauce as it thickens in the fridge.
I would not freeze this sauce with a milk base. It does not freeze well.

Marry Me Chicken
This Marry Me Chicken Recipe is one of my all-time favorite chicken recipes. You have tender and juicy chicken in a creamy basil and sundried tomato sauce that marries each other the same way you will get a marriage proposal after making this recipe.
Ingredients
- 1.5lbs Chicken breast or 3 larger breasts
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on pepper
- ¼ cup all purpose flour
- 4 tablespoons ghee or butter
- 1 ½ teaspoons minced garlic
- 1 cup chicken stock
- 1 cup heavy cream
- ½ cup grated parmesan cheese
- ½ te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
- 1 teaspoon italian seasoning
- ½ cup sundried tomato strips
- Fresh basil for garnish
Instructions
- Cut the chicken breasts into cutlets until you have 6 total cutlets.
- Season the chicken with salt and pepper, then dredge in the flour.
- In a large cast-iron skillet, melt the ghee or butter over medium heat.
- Once the ghee or butter is melted Sear the chicken on both sides for 5 minutes, and work in batches. Set aside.
- Bring the heat to a medium-low and
- In the same cast-iron skillet add the garlic and cook until fragrant, about 30 seconds.
- Add the chicken stock, heavy cream, parmesan cheese, crushed red pepper flakes, and Italian seasoning.
- Allow to come to a simmer, stirring constantly.
- Add the sundried tomatoes and the chicken and let simmer for 5 minutes or until thickened slightly.
- Garnish the chicken with fresh chopped basil and serve over pasta.
